List of ingredients for Cheese and smoky bacon soup with celery


* 25 g (1 oz) Butter
* 1 small Onion, peeled and finely chopped
* 1 stick of Celery, finely sliced - run a speed-peeler along the back to remove any tough strings
* 25 g (1 oz) Plain flour
* 275 ml (1/2 pint) full Cream Milk
* 275 ml (1/2 pint) Chicken or Vegetable stock
* 100 g (4 oz) Cheese of choice, such as strong Cheddar cheese, Grated
* Sea salt and Freshly ground black pepper
* 3 rashers of lean Smoked bacon or Home smoked bacon

===Method===
* Grill the Bacon until crispy then allow to cool so it can be handled
* Melt the Butter in a pan, give a good grind of Black pepper and gently sauté the Onion and Celery without colouring, about 10 minutes
* Remove from the heat, stir in the Flour and gradually whisk in the Milk and Stock
* Slowly bring to the Boil and stir well until the Soup starts to thicken.
* Reduce the heat and Simmer for 5 minutes then add the Cheese and season with Salt and extra Pepper if needed. Stir well and simmer for a further 5 minutes
* Thin with a little Milk or Cream if desired
